| Background | CCNB2 (Cyclin B2) is a Protein Coding gene. Diseases associated with CCNB2 include Anauxetic Dysplasia 1 and Breast Cancer. Among its related pathways are Arrhythmogenic right ventricular cardiomyopathy (ARVC) and Regulation of PLK1 Activity at G2/M Transition. |
